.u-01{font-size:40px;font-style:normal;font-weight:500;line-height:72px;letter-spacing:3.2px}@media (max-width: 767px){.u-01{font-size:24px;line-height:56px;letter-spacing:1.92px}}.u-05{font-size:40px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:3.2px;margin-bottom:12px}@media (max-width: 768px){.u-05{text-align:center;font-size:24px;letter-spacing:1.92px;margin-bottom:8px}}.u-06{font-size:14px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:1.12px;margin-top:12px}@media (max-width: 768px){.u-06{text-align:center;font-size:12px;letter-spacing:.96px;margin-top:8px}}.button--primary_outline{border-radius:80px;border:1px solid #222;padding:16px 0;width:214px;text-align:center;font-size:13px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1.04px}.button--primary_transparency{background:#f000;border:1px solid rgb(var(--button-background))}@media (max-width: 767px){.section__header{margin-block-end:min(12px,var(--vertical-breather))}}@media (max-width: 767px){.section__footer{margin-top:48px}}.announcement-bar{border-bottom:1px solid rgba(34,34,34,.08)}.header__wrapper{padding:12px 0}.header__linklist-item{font-size:15px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1.2px}.header__linklist-item:not(:last-child){margin-inline-end:56px}.footer__aside{padding-top:25px;border-top:1px solid rgba(34,34,34,1)}@media (max-width: 767px){.footer__aside{margin-block-start:0px;padding-top:0;border-top:1px solid rgba(34,34,34,0);text-align:center}}.footer{padding-top:40px;padding-bottom:22px}@media (max-width: 767px){.footer{padding-top:33px;padding-bottom:22px}}.social_media_wrapper{margin-top:24px}.social-media{gap:8px}.social-media__item{border-radius:80px}.linklist__item{font-size:12px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.96px}.linklist__item2{font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.6px}.linklist__item:not(:first-child){padding-block-start:12px}.footer__item-title{font-size:14px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1.12px;padding-bottom:14px;border-bottom:1px solid rgba(34,34,34,1);margin-bottom:16px}.footer__item--newsletter{max-width:480px}.footer__item-content p{font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.6px}@media (max-width: 767px){.footer__item-content p{margin-bottom:26px}}.footer__item-list .input .input__field.input__field--text{width:85%}.input__submit-icon{border-radius:2px;background:var(--black-222222, #222);color:#fff;padding:12px}.footer__newsletter-form input{padding-right:0}@media (max-width: 767px){.footer__item.footer__item--image.is-first{margin:0 auto}}@media (max-width: 767px){.footer__copyright{justify-content:center}}@media (max-width: 767px){.footer__item-list{gap:32px}}.mobile-nav__item .mobile-nav__link{font-size:15px;font-style:normal;font-weight:400!important;line-height:normal;letter-spacing:1.2px}.drawer__content{padding-top:21px}.mobile-nav__footer .icon-text{padding:16px 0;width:285px;border-radius:80px;background:var(--black-222222, #222);color:#fff;text-align:center;display:block}.mobile-nav__item{border-bottom:1px solid rgba(var(--text-color),.15)}.drawer__footer--bordered{box-shadow:none;padding-bottom:40px}.article-item__title{font-size:16px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:1.28px}@media (max-width: 767px){.article-item__title{font-size:14px;letter-spacing:1.12px}}.article-item__image-container{margin-block-end:12px}.article_item_category_date_wrapper{display:flex;justify-content:space-between;align-items:center}.article-item__category{font-size:12px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.96px}.article_item_date{font-size:13px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1.04px}@media (max-width: 767px){.article_item_date{font-size:12px;letter-spacing:.96px}}.article-list{margin-inline:0}.image-with-text__content-wrapper{width:45%;margin-inline-end:64px}@media (max-width: 768px){.image-with-text__content-wrapper{width:100%;margin-inline-end:0px}}.title_wrapper{padding-bottom:32px;border-bottom:1px solid #222}.image-with-text__text-wrapper{margin-top:32px}.image-with-text__content p{font-size:24px;font-style:normal;font-weight:500;line-height:40px;letter-spacing:1.2px}@media (max-width: 767px){.image-with-text__content p{font-size:18px;line-height:36px;letter-spacing:.9px}}.image-with-text__content2 p{font-size:16px;font-style:normal;font-weight:500;line-height:36px;letter-spacing:.8px;padding-top:24px}@media (max-width: 767px){.image-with-text__content2 p{font-size:13px;line-height:26px;letter-spacing:.65px}}.image-with-text__content3 p{font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.6px;padding-top:16px}@media (max-width: 767px){.image-with-text__content3 p{font-size:11px;letter-spacing:.55px}}.product-item__info{text-align:left}.product-item-meta__title{font-size:16px;font-style:normal;font-weight:400;line-height:28px;letter-spacing:1.28px}@media (max-width: 767px){.product-item-meta__title{font-size:12px;line-height:20px;letter-spacing:.96px}}.price{font-size:16px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.32px;margin-top:8px;margin-bottom:12px}@media (max-width: 767px){.price{font-size:14px;letter-spacing:.28px;margin-top:4px;margin-bottom:8px}}.rating__caption{font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.96px}@media (max-width: 767px){.rating__caption{font-size:11px;letter-spacing:.88px}}.product-category-tags{margin-top:16px}.product-category-tag{color:#4a4a4a;font-size:12px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.96px;padding-right:16px}@media (max-width: 767px){.product-category-tag{font-size:10px;letter-spacing:.8px;padding-right:8px}}.product-category-tag_info{color:#222}.multi-column__text_title{font-size:40px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:3.2px;margin-top:0;margin-bottom:0}@media (max-width: 767px){.multi-column__text_title{font-size:28px;letter-spacing:2.24px}}.multi-column__text_title{position:relative;padding:0}.multi-column__text_title:before{position:absolute;top:calc(50% - 1px);left:0;width:100%;height:2px;content:"";background:#000}.multi-column__text_title span{position:relative;padding:0 16px 0 0;background:#fff}.multi-column__text_subtitle{font-size:18px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:1.44px;margin-top:16px;margin-bottom:0}@media (max-width: 767px){.multi-column__text_subtitle{font-size:18px;letter-spacing:1.44px}}.multi-column__text_content{font-size:14px;font-style:normal;font-weight:500;line-height:28px;letter-spacing:1.12px;margin-top:16px;margin-bottom:0}@media (max-width: 767px){.multi-column__text_content{font-size:13px;line-height:26px;letter-spacing:1.04px}}.product-meta__title_lineup{font-size:20px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1px}.drawer__footer_button{border-radius:80px}@media (max-width: 767px){.container_main_product{padding:0}}@media (max-width: 767px){.container_product_info{padding-left:15px;padding-right:15px}}.product-meta__title{font-size:20px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1px;margin-top:24px;margin-bottom:20px}@media (max-width: 767px){.product-meta__title{font-size:15px;letter-spacing:.75px}}.product-meta{border-bottom:1px solid #222}.product-meta__reference{margin-top:0}.product-form__text .metafield-multi_line_text_field{font-size:18px;font-style:normal;font-weight:500;line-height:36px;letter-spacing:.9px}@media (max-width: 767px){.product-form__text .metafield-multi_line_text_field{font-size:15px;line-height:30px;letter-spacing:.75px}}@media (max-width: 767px){.product-form__text{padding-bottom:40px}}.product_inventory_share_wrapper{display:flex;justify-content:space-between}.product_media_container{padding-left:0}@media (max-width: 767px){.product_media_container{padding-left:17px}}.price--large:not(.price--compare){font-size:20px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.4px}@media (max-width: 767px){.price--large:not(.price--compare){font-size:16px;letter-spacing:.32px}}.product-content__featured-products-title{font-size:24px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:1.92px}@media (max-width: 767px){.product-content__featured-products-title{text-align:center}}.product-content__featured-products-subtitle{font-size:14px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:1.12px;margin-top:8px}@media (max-width: 767px){.product-content__featured-products-subtitle{text-align:center}}.product-item-meta__title{font-size:14px;font-style:normal;font-weight:400;line-height:24px;letter-spacing:1.12px}@media (max-width: 767px){.product-item-meta__title{font-size:12px;letter-spacing:.96px}}.product-item__cta-wrapper{text-align:center;margin-top:20px}@media (max-width: 767px){.product-item__cta-wrapper{text-align:left;margin-top:10px}}.inventory{font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.24px}.product-meta__share-label{font-size:15px;font-style:normal;font-weight:500;line-height:26px;letter-spacing:.75px}.product-tabs__tab-item-content.rte p{font-size:14px;font-style:normal;font-weight:500;line-height:28px;letter-spacing:1.12px}@media (max-width: 767px){.product-content__featured-products .product-item__image-wrapper{width:165px;margin-inline-end:16px}}@media (max-width: 767px){.product-content__featured-products-list{display:block;gap:20px}}@media (max-width: 767px){.product-content__featured-products-list .product-item+.product-item{margin-top:20px}}.tabs_nav__item_origin{font-size:13px;font-style:normal;line-height:normal;letter-spacing:1.04px;padding-bottom:13px}@media (max-width: 767px){.collapsible_toggle_origin{font-size:14px;letter-spacing:1.12px}}@media (max-width: 767px){.label{padding:4px 12px}}@media (max-width: 767px){.product-form__button{text-align:center}}.page-content--large{max-width:1000px}.page-content.rte h2{font-size:24px;font-style:normal;font-weight:500;line-height:40px;letter-spacing:1.2px;border-bottom:1px solid #222;padding-bottom:24px}@media (max-width: 767px){.page-content.rte h2{font-size:18px;line-height:36px;letter-spacing:.9px;padding-bottom:16px}}.page-content.rte p{font-size:16px;font-style:normal;font-weight:500;line-height:36px;letter-spacing:.8px;margin-bottom:80px}@media (max-width: 767px){.page-content.rte p{font-size:13px;line-height:26px;letter-spacing:.65px;margin-bottom:64px}}.marker_line{background:linear-gradient(transparent 40%,#efe3d2 60%);line-height:1}.jdgm-rev__cf-ans--type:not(:last-of-type){display:flex;gap:40px}.jdgm-cf__options:not([data-type=text]){display:flex!important;gap:10px!important}.link-bar__link-item{display:flex}.article__title{font-size:20px;font-style:normal;font-weight:700;line-height:normal;letter-spacing:1px;font-family:YuGothic,Yu Gothic,sans-serif}@media (max-width: 767px){.article__title{font-size:18px;line-height:32px;letter-spacing:1.44px}}.breadcrumb__list.unstyled-list{font-family:YuGothic,Yu Gothic,sans-serif}
/*# sourceMappingURL=/cdn/shop/t/12/assets/custom.css.map */
